不同的杨氏模量对含裂纹复合材料板裂纹周围应力的影响研究

摘    要:不同的杨氏模量对于应力场有着相当的影响.针对含裂纹的复合材料板,根据非均质各向异性弹性理论和复变函数理论解决了裂纹的边界条件问题.建立了基于准确边界条件的边界积分方程,得到了舍裂纹复合材料板裂纹周围应力场的精确解析解.并按照所建立的计算模型对不同的杨氏模量对裂纹周围应力场的影响进行了探讨.

Effects of Different Young' s Modulus on Stress Around Cracks in Composite Material Plate

Abstract:Different Young's Modulus has considerable effects on the stress field.Taking aim at the stress state of composite material plate with crack,the boundary condition problem of crack is solved with the heterogeneous anisotropic elastic theory and complex variable function.The boundary integralequation based on exact boundary conditions is established.The accurate analytic solution of stress field around the crack in the composite materials plate is obtained.Moreover,based on the calculation model,effects of different Young's Modulus on the stress field around the crack in the composite materials plate are investigated.
